Alternative Ingredient Suggestions

If you’re missing an ingredient or want to customize the fritters, here are some alternatives:

  • Chickpeas: White beans or butter beans can be used in place of chickpeas for a slightly different flavor and texture.
  • Flour: Use chickpea flour for a gluten-free option, or whole wheat flour for a heartier version.
  • Cheese: Skip the Parmesan and opt for a dairy-free alternative like nutritional yeast, which provides a cheesy flavor.
  • Herbs: Parsley can be swapped with fresh basil, dill, or cilantro to suit your preferences.

Step-by-Step Instructions for Making Chickpea Fritters

Making chickpea fritters is simple! Follow these easy steps:

  1. Prepare the Mixture: In a medium bowl, combine the chickpeas, flour, Parmesan cheese, parsley, cumin,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Mash the Chickpeas: Use a fork or potato masher to mash the ingredients together. Add 1-2 tablespoons of water until the mixture forms a cohesive texture.
  3. Shape the Fritters: Divide the mixture into 6 equal portions and form each portion into a small patty. Press gently to flatten them slightly.
  4. Fry the Fritters: Heat the canola oil in a pan over medium heat. Once the oil is hot, carefully add the patties and fry for about 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own and crispy.
  5. Drain and Serve: Place the fritters on a paper towel-lined plate to absorb any excess oil. Serve warm with tahini sauce or your favorite dipping sauce.

Tips & Tricks for Perfect Chickpea Fritters

  • Consistent Texture: The key to perfect fritters is the right texture. If your mixture is too wet, the fritters will fall apart, and if it’s too dry, they’ll be crumbly. Start with a small amount of water and add more only if needed.
  • Dry Chickpeas: Be sure to rinse and thoroughly dry your chickpeas to prevent excess moisture, which can make the fritters greasy.
  • Temperature Control: Maintain medium heat while frying. If the oil isn’t hot enough, the fritters will absorb too much oil and become soggy. Test the oil by dropping in a small piece—if it sizzles immediately, it’s ready.
  •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: Fry the fritters in batches to avoid overcrowding, which can cause them to cook unevenly.

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ips

Chickpea fritters are perfect for meal prep or leftovers:

  • Storage: Keep the fritters in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Place a paper towel in the container to absorb any moisture and keep them crispy.
  • Make Ahead: You can prep the fritter mixture up to 24 hours in advance and store it in the fridge. When ready to cook, just give it a quick stir and proceed with frying.
  • Reheating: To re-crisp the fritters, heat them in a skillet over medium heat for a few minutes on each side. You can also warm them in the oven at 350°F for 5-7 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I use dried chickpeas instead of canned for these fritters?

Yes, you can absolutely use dried chickpeas instead of canned ones. If you go this route, be sure to soak the chickpeas overnight and cook them until they are tender. Once cooked, drain and dry them thoroughly before using them in the fritter mixture.

How do I get the fritters crispy without deep-frying them?

The key to crispy chickpea fritters is pan-frying them at the right temperature. Ensure the oil is hot enough to create a sizzle when the fritters are added to the pan. Cook them over medium heat, allowing each side to brown for 3-4 minutes. Avoid overcrowding the pan to ensure even cooking and crispiness.

Can I make chickpea fritters gluten-free?

Yes, you can easily make these fritters gluten-free by swapping the plain flour for chickpea flour. Chickpea flour will absorb more liquid, so you may need to add a tablespoon of water to get the right texture for the fritters. Additionally, ensure any optional ingredients like cheese are suitable for your dietary needs.

Description

These flavorful chickpea fritters are crispy on the outside, tender on the inside, and packed with fresh herbs, warm spices, and a hint of garlic. Quick to make and perfect for a quick dinner or appetizer.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 can chickpeas (15 ounces, rinsed and drained)
  • 1/4 cup plain flour
  • 1/4 cup par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 tablespoon parsley,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 2 tablespoons canola oil
  • Tahini sauce for serving

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ine the chickpeas, flour, Parmesan cheese, parsley, cumin,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Use a fork or potato masher to mash the mixture until it’s well combined and forms a cohesive texture.
  3. Add 1-2 tablespoons of water to the mixture and mix until it holds together.
  4. Divide the mixture into 6 equal parts and shape each portion into a small patty.
  5. Heat the canola oil in a pan over medium heat. Once hot, carefully add the fritters to the pan.
  6. Cook for 3-4 minutes on each side until they are golden brown and crispy.
  7. Place the fritters on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
  8. Serve warm with tahini sauce or your favorite dipping sauce.

Notes

  • Ensure the chickpeas are thoroughly dried after rinsing to avoid soggy fritters.
  • Use medium heat for frying to avoid greasy fritters.
  • For a gluten-free version, substitute plain flour with chickpea flour.
  • To keep fritters crispy, store them in an airtight container with a paper towel inside to absorb moisture.
  • To reheat, use a skillet or oven to crisp them up again.
